G845 – calculating hole positions
G845 A1 .. calculates the hole positions and stores them at
the reference specified in NF. The cycle takes the diameter of
the active tool into account when calculating the hole positions.
Therefore, you need to insert the drill before calling G845 A1...
Program only the parameters given in the following table.

Parameters:
ID: Milling contour – name of the milling contour
NS: Starting block no. of contour – beginning of contour
section
Figures: Block number of the figure
Free closed contour: First contour element (not starting
point)
B: Milling depth (default: hole depth from the contour definition)
XS: Millg. top edge lateral surface (replaces the reference plane
from the contour definition)
ZS: Millg. top edge face (replaces the reference plane from the
contour definition)
I: O-size X
K: O-size Z
Q: Mach. direction (default: 0)
0: From the inside out
1: From the outside in
A: (Mill=0/PredrillPos=1)
NF: Position mark – reference at which the cycle stores the
hole positions (range: 1 to 127)
WB: Plunging length – diameter of the milling cutter
G845 overwrites any hole positions that may still be
stored at the reference NF
The parameter WB is used both for calculating the
hole positions and for milling. When calculating the
hole positions, WB describes the diameter of the
milling cutter.
